[NOTE]
I think a lot of people don't realize how many opportunities they're given on a daily basis, and to really go after those things.
我覺得很多人都沒有發現自己每天都有好多機會,也沒有好好把握它們。
1. _
* realize [ˋrɪə͵laɪz] (v.) 明白;認識到;意識到
- After waiting outside the bathroom for 15 minutes I realized there was no one inside.
+ 在浴室外等了15分鐘後,我意識到裡面沒有人。
- He later found out that the milk he drank earlier was camel milk his face Twisted in disgust as he came to the realization of what he drank.
+ 他後來發現,他早些時候喝的牛奶是駱駝奶,他的臉因厭惡而扭曲,因為他意識到自己喝了什麼。
2. _
* opportunity [͵ɑpɚˋtjunətɪ] (n.) 機遇;時機;機會;可能性
- My girlfriend is going on a business trip this Friday I decided to take this opportunity to shop for an engagement ring while she is away.
+ 我的女朋友本週五正在出差,我決定藉此機會在她不在的時候購買訂婚戒指。
3. _
* basis [ˋbesɪs] (n.) 基礎;根據;行動(或進程)的方式
- Steve works out at a gym on a regular basis that is why he's so fit.
+ 史蒂夫定期在健身房工作,這就是他如此健康的原因。
4. _
* go after sth. [] (ph.) 追逐;追求;謀求
- Now that I have saved up enough money I should buy a nice camera and go after my dream of being a YouTuber.
+ 現在我已經積攢了足夠的錢,我應該買一台漂亮的相機並追求我作為YouTuber的夢想。
- The robber grabbed my wallet and ran I'd have gone after him but I was in a state of shock.
+ 強盜搶了我的錢包然後跑了,我應該追逐他,但是我處於一種震驚的狀態。

I think a lot of people don’t realize how many opportunities they’ve given on a daily basis, and to really go after those things.
realize (v.) means to understand the situation, sometimes suddenly.
*After waiting outside the bathroom for 15 minutes, I realized there was no one inside.
realization (n.) means the fact or moment of starting to understand a situation.
*He later found out that the milk he drank earlier was camel milk. His face twisted in disgust as he came to the realization of what he drank.
opportunity (n.) means an occasion or situation that makes it possible to do something that you want to do or have to do, or the possibility of doing something.
*My girlfriend is going on a business trip this Friday. I decided to take this opportunity to shop for an engagement ring while she is away.
basis (n.) means the most important facts, ideas, etc. from which something is developed, a way or method of doing something.
*Steve works out at a gym on a regular basis, that is why he's so fit.
go after sth. (ph.) means to try to get something.
*Now that I have saved up enough money, I should buy a nice camera and go after my dream of being a YouTuber.
go after sb.(ph.) means to chase or to follow someone in order to catch.
*The robber grabbed my wallet and ran. I'd have gone after him, but I was in a state of shock.
